AJR 25 New Jersey General Assembly · 2024-2025 Regular Session

Designates first week of May of each year as Wounded Warrior Appreciation Week.

AJR 25 designates the first full week of May each year as "Wounded Warrior Appreciation Week" in New Jersey. This symbolic resolution aims to raise public awareness about the challenges faced by military veterans with physical or mental injuries sustained in service, including those with combat-related stress, PTSD, or traumatic brain injuries. It requests the governor issue a proclamation encouraging New Jersey residents and officials to observe the week with activities honoring wounded warriors. The bill does not create new programs, allocate funding, or impose obligations on state agencies - it is purely a ceremonial designation.
